EU Relations

EU legislation has a great impact on the Danish municipalities. A survey issued by KL in 2020 concludes that the EU affects 43 per cent of the agenda items at local council meetings.

    The ways in which the EU affects the municipalities vary across different policy areas such as environment, labour market, education and matters of financial support to local authorities.

    Influencing EU policies and legislation is thus an important part of KL's operations. It is the responsibility of the EU-Office to organise and promote the interests of the Danish municipalities in the EU. The EU office is represented in Copenhagen and in Brussels. The office is organised around two main pillars:

    • Influencing European policy and legislation in the EU institutions, local and regional fora, the Danish Parliament, the Danish European Affairs Committees and the Danish Government.
    • Assisting KL's members in the Committee of the Regions and other EU fora.
